I have being practicing QiGong for the past three months under Master Yap with the National Cancer Society  Malaysia. Now almost on practically a daily basis. The form of Qigong I practice is Zhineng QiGong.

There are as many forms of QiGong as there are masters of the practice. In the book The complete idiot’s guide to Tai Chi and QiGong, master Bill Douglas  (Founder of World Tai Chi and QiGong Day) explained that Tai Chi is a form of QiGong, and they are essentially the same. They stem from the same roots for concepts and movements. However whilst Tai Chi is totally QiGong, All QiGong is Not Tai Chi.
